Solution

The correct option is D ferrous oxalate.
Ferrous oxalate is capable of decolorizing acidified KMnO4 solution.

Acidified KMnO4 is an oxidizing agent. It will oxidize the oxalate ions into carbon dioxide. In the process, it will decolorize because of the reduction of the violet permanganate ions into colorless manganous ions.

Option (D) is correct.
